Quick Assessment
This interactive board book engages early readers with movable pivots and peekaboo holes that reveal various farm animals. Designed for ages 5-8, it encourages observation and guessing skills as Mother Hen searches for her missing chick. The simple text and bright illustrations make it ideal for beginning readers, with no content concerns.
